"Rolling Up The Hill" is the seventh full length album from British folk singer/songwriter, Beans On Toast, released 1st December 2015 on the Xtra Mile Recordings label.
Rolling Up the Hill is Beans' most creative record to date and it’s an album all about friendship, travel and art. It’s also about drinking, protesting and growing older in these strange modern times.
It was recorded in August with husband and wife country duo Truckstop Honeymoon in Kansas. The duo brings together double bass, mandolin and finger picking sounds to Beans on Toast's unique style of songwriting. They were still joined by long-term partner in crime Bobby Banjo, on harp and banjo. Throw in a couple of Kansas players dropping in some horns and some drums and you’ve got a Beans on Toast album that is fresh, fun and exciting while at the same time not losing any of Beans on Toast’s original, cheap and easy English attitude that has got him to where he is today.
